Costco Sets to Boost Executive Membership Perks
In a move that is expected to delight its loyal customers, Costco has announced that its higher-priced membership tier will soon come with a coveted perk. As of June, executive members in the US will be able to shop an hour earlier than standard members.
The Benefits of Executive Membership
For those who are not familiar with Costco's membership tiers, here is a brief overview:
- Gold Star Membership: The basic membership tier that costs around $60 per year. Gold star members can shop at all Costco warehouses worldwide and access various online services.
- Executive Membership: The premium membership tier that costs around $120 per year. Executive members receive additional benefits, including 2% cashback on most purchases, travel insurance, and access to exclusive events.
